Tree removal services involve the careful cutting and elimination of trees that are no longer healthy, pose safety risks, or interfere with property use. Skilled contractors use specialized equipment and techniques to safely remove trees of various sizes, ensuring that the surrounding landscape remains undamaged. This service is often necessary when a tree is dead, dying, or structurally compromised, making it vulnerable to falling and potentially causing damage or injury. Proper tree removal can also be part of a larger property improvement plan, such as clearing space for new construction or landscaping projects.
Many property owners turn to tree removal services to address specific problems that threaten safety or property value. Overgrown or unstable trees can pose a risk of falling during storms or high winds, especially if they have dead branches or signs of disease. Trees that are too close to buildings, power lines, or driveways may need to be removed to prevent damage or accidents. Additionally, trees that obstruct views, sunlight, or access to a property can be safely removed to improve the overall usability and appearance of a yard or landscape.

The overview below groups typical Tree Removal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Acton, MA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Tree Removals - typical costs for removing individual small trees range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the tree size and location. Fewer projects reach the higher end for more complex or hard-to-access trees.
Medium-Sized Tree Removal - removing larger trees usually costs between $600 and $1,500. These projects often involve more equipment and labor, with most jobs falling into this range. Larger or more challenging trees can push costs higher, sometimes exceeding $2,000.
Stump Removal and Grinding - stump removal services typically cost between $100 and $400 per stump. Many projects are within this range, but larger stumps or multiple stumps can increase the price. Some complex stumps may require additional work, raising the cost further.
Full Tree Removal Projects - complete removal of multiple or large trees can range from $1,500 to $5,000 or more. Most projects are within this range, but highly complex or hazardous jobs can reach higher prices depending on scope and site conditions.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
